House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ation of a property to correct uneven or settling floors, cracks in walls, and other structural issues caused by soil movement or shifting foundations. These services are commonly requested for homes experiencing noticeable sloping, doors that do not close properly, or cracks in the walls and ceilings. Property owners should understand the extent of the foundation problem, the methods used to restore stability, and any potential impacts on the property’s structure before requesting a house leveling service.

Typically, house leveling projects cover a range of residential properties, including single-family homes, multi-story dwellings, and even some commercial buildings. Homeowners often want to know how the process will affect their property, what signs indicate the need for leveling, and how long the repairs might take. Understanding these factors can help property owners make informed decisions about addressing foundation issues and maintaining the safety and value of their homes.

Common House Leveling Jobs

Foundation leveling - adjusting a home's foundation to correct uneven settling.

Slab stabilization - reinforcing and lifting concrete slabs to prevent cracks and movement.

Pier and beam leveling - realigning support structures beneath homes with pier and beam systems.

Post and column adjustment - restoring stability by leveling vertical supports in the structure.

Structural repair for uneven floors - addressing floor sagging caused by shifting or settling foundations.

Crack repair and reinforcement - sealing and stabilizing cracks resulting from shifting foundations.

House Leveling Questions

What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ting a building's foundation to correct uneven settling or shifting, ensuring stability and proper alignment.

When is house leveling needed? House leveling is often required when there are noticeable c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.

What methods are used for house leveling? Common methods include mudjacking, piering, or underpinning to raise and stabilize the foundation.

How can property owners tell if their house needs leveling? Signs include sloping floors, cracked walls, or gaps around door and window frames that no longer fit properly.
